The cocktail dress that does the work itself

When time is short, the most reliable choice is a single great dress in a refined fabric — one that requires no coordination, no second-guessing, and no additional styling decisions. You put it on and you are dressed.

A stretch crepe cocktail dress in a solid jewel tone or classic black has the structure to look polished and the give to feel genuinely comfortable across a full evening. The Stretch Crepe Sheath Short Dress with its embellished neckline and puff elbow sleeves is exactly this kind of dress — it does the styling work itself, which means the only decision left is which shoes to wear.

What makes a cocktail dress the right last-minute choice:

  • A solid color requires no pattern-matching or coordination

  • An embellished neckline or interesting sleeve eliminates the need for statement jewelry

  • A fabric with stretch is comfortable from the moment you put it on through to the end of the evening

  • Knee-length and short styles work across the widest range of cocktail and semi-formal occasions

The floor-length gown — fully dressed, completely radiant

For formal and black tie occasions, a floor-length gown is the most complete choice available. One dress, fully dressed, nothing else required. The key under time pressure is choosing a fluid fabric — stretch crepe, chiffon, soft jersey — that is more forgiving of fit and more comfortable across a long evening than a heavily structured one.

Long dresses in deep jewel tones or classic black and metallic shades work across the widest range of formal occasions. You do not need to know the specific dress code to know that a floor-length gown in a rich fabric is going to look wonderful.

The strongest last-minute options at this length:

  • A metallic gown — inherently festive, works for black tie and formal without needing a single addition

  • A navy long dress — authoritative, deeply flattering, and appropriate for virtually every formal setting

  • A sequin gown in a simple silhouette — fully dressed, completely radiant, with the least additional styling required of any option

The lace dress — timeless, luminous, and effortlessly dressed

Lace dresses have a quality that requires almost no styling to activate. The texture and detail of the lace does the work — it photographs beautifully, suits candlelit and evening settings naturally, and reads as considered and elegant at every level of formality from cocktail through to black tie.

A lace dress with a stretch lining is one of the most comfortable formal options available — the lace provides the beauty, the lining moves with the body. In a deep jewel tone or a classic black, a lace dress is a last-minute choice that looks anything but.

The jacket dress — one purchase, completely dressed

A jacket dress is the closest thing formal dressing has to a single, complete solution. The jacket and dress are designed to be worn together — same fabric, coordinating details, proportions that work as a unit — which means the look is finished the moment you put it on.

Under time pressure, the jacket dress removes every variable except fit. Find one that fits and you are done. It handles coverage for conservative venues, comes off for the reception, and photographs as one polished, complete look from every angle. For mothers of the bride and groom especially, a jacket dress is the most reliable last-minute choice there is — because it looks like anything but a last-minute choice.


A few things that make any dress work faster

Whatever you reach for, a few principles apply across all of them:

  • An embellished neckline or interesting detail on the dress eliminates the need to source statement jewelry — one less decision under time pressure

  • Fabric with stretch is more forgiving of fit, which matters when there is no time for alterations

  • A solid color or refined print requires fewer coordination decisions than a complex pattern

  • A small clutch in a neutral metallic — gold, silver, champagne — works with everything and requires no thought

  • A heel you can walk in confidently matters more than the most beautiful shoe in the room — ease shows, and so does discomfort
